JUSTICE ASHWANI KUMAR SINGH ORAL JUDGMENT Date: 09-05-2016 By way of the present application preferred under Section 482 of the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973, the petitioners seek quashing of the order dated 20.08.2015 passed by Sri. A. K. Pandey, learned Judicial Magistrate, 1st Class, Darbhanga in C R No. 1451 of 2012 by which bail bond of the petitioners has been cancelled.
2.
It is stated by learned counsel for the petitioners that due to non appearance of the petitioners for one day, the learned Magistrate cancelled the bail bond of the petitioners and
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.53042 of 2015 dt.09-05-2016 2/2 issued non-bailable warrant of arrest against them by a composite order without assigning any reason.
3.
I have perused the impugned order dated 20.08.2015, which reads as under;- " All 02 accused absent.
Complainant is in attendance.
Bail Bond of all accused cancelled.
O/c is directed to issue NBW against all accused.
Put up for appearance on 30.09.15."
4.
A reading of the aforesaid order passed by the learned Magistrate would make it evident that the same is cryptic in nature. Though, the court below is not required to write an elaborate judgment for canceling the bail bond and issuing nonbailable warrant of arrest against an accused, it is expected to adduce some reason for its logical conclusion, as reason is the heartbeat of every conclusion.
5.
In that view of the matter, the impugned order dated 20.08.2015 cannot be sustained. It is set aside, accordingly. 6.
In the result, this application is allowed.
